But most importantly, it doesn't change too many in-game features. It is what the title says, an improvement, but not an overhaul or change.
http://www.moddb.com/mods/improvement-mod/downloads
There are a few changes here and there like trade route trains are now dangerous if you are standing on the tracks, the Fort build option is completely redone ( I don't really care for it, but its minor compared to the GOOD parts of the mod), Walls have more upgrades and can now be built over trade routes. Buildings (except town cernters) are rotatable, There is a new resource, "Fame" that is totally optional. It is used to order unique units.
The difficulty seems relatively the same. I'd check it out at least, from the link above.
